Bet99 Sportsbook Review

Moneyline Rating
4.5/5

Launched in 2020, Bet99 Sportsbook is a Canadian-focused betting platform operated by BQC Consulting GmbH and licensed under the Kahnawake Gaming Commission. In 2022, Bet99 received full approval to operate in Ontario under iGaming Ontario, making it one of the region’s regulated options for bettors.

With a strong local presence, Canadian ambassadors like Georges St-Pierre, and sponsorships across hockey and MMA, Bet99 has quickly become a recognizable name in the Canadian sports betting landscape. The platform offers competitive odds, a user-friendly interface, and a wide variety of markets across both sports and casino gaming.


What Makes Bet99 Unique?

Canadian Focus Tailored to Canadian bettors with markets for NHL, CFL, and North American leagues.

Celebrity Partnerships Endorsements from Georges St-Pierre and collaborations with local sports teams.

Bilingual Platform Full English and French support for Canadian users.

Integrated Sports & Casino One account covers both sportsbook and online casino play.

Localized Payments Supports Interac, Instadebit, and Canadian banking methods.

Live Streaming Select sports and esports events available directly in-app.

Bet99 at a Glance

Founded
2020
Available Regions
Canada (regulated in Ontario)
Rewards Program
None (promo-driven)
Mobile App
iOS & Android
Live Betting
Yes
Early Cash Out
Yes
Same Game Parlays
Yes
In-App Streaming
Yes (select sports & esports)
Payment Methods
Interac, Instadebit, iDebit, Visa, Mastercard, ecoPayz, MuchBetter, Bank Transfer
Payout Speed:
1–3 Business Days (e-wallets often same day)
Customer Support
Live Chat, Email, Help Center
